We have a computer at one of our locations we use for emails.

I copied the invoice databases from the invoice computer to that one so past invoices can be searched if needed.

When I did that, each time I open the database I get the message: Some or all of the programming in this form has failed to compile.  No event programming will run.

I encountered this problem a few years back and was given the fix, but I forgot what it was.

I can open the databases, but none of the command buttons work.

Check that the Sbasic_include.sbas file is in your working directory(Usually C:\Sesame2) which is specified in the Start In Property of the shortcut that you use to start Sesame

Also check that you are running the same version of Sesame.
